I enabled JPA logging.

I do see a message that it is creating the ticket.
   [org.apereo.cas.ticket.registry.JpaTicketRegistry] Added ticket [xxx] to 
registry.

30ms later I see a message that the ticket is being destroyed:
   [org.apereo.cas.web.flow.login.SendTicketGrantingTicketAction] (default 
task-6) Setting ticket-granting cookie for current session linked to [xxx].
   [org.apereo.cas.web.flow.GenerateServiceTicketAction] (default task-6) 
Ticket-granting ticket found in the context is [xxx]
   [org.apereo.cas.ticket.registry.JpaTicketRegistry] (default task-6) No 
record could be found for ticket
   [org.apereo.cas.web.flow.GenerateServiceTicketAction] (default task-6) 
CAS has determined ticket-granting ticket [xxx] is invalid and must be 
destroyed
   [org.apereo.cas.ticket.registry.JpaTicketRegistry] (default task-6) No 
record could be found for ticket [xxx]
   [org.apereo.cas.ticket.registry.AbstractTicketRegistry] (default task-6) 
Ticket [xxx] could not be fetched from the registry; it may have been 
expired and deleted.

Even though it logs "must be destroyed", it does not appear that this is 
actually removing from db because I still see the TGT in the table.

Looks like 30ms is too fast to query for a ticket after it has been added. 
Is there a retry or delay config that can be added? Doesn't happen often 
but often enough to cause a bad user experience.
